
Amman, Oct. 5 (Petra) – The Agricultural Credit Corporation (ACC), in cooperation with the Agricultural Materials Traders & Producers Association, launched a new initiative on Sunday to support farmers by providing interest-free loans.
The initiative is part of the public-private partnership and implementation of the development priorities outlined in the Economic Modernization Vision.
According to an ACC statement, the decision aims to alleviate financial burdens on farmers and avoid their exploitation in the prices of production inputs under a financing system.
Under the new mechanism, farmers will receive loans at preferential prices without incurring bank interest costs, as suppliers will cover the financing costs on behalf of farmers.
The statement added that the initiative came after “extensive” consultations with representatives of the Kingdom’s agricultural sector to deliver positive outcomes on all stakeholders involved in the Kingdom’s agricultural value chain.
The initiative also contributes to improving “efficiency” of agricultural financing and achieving its immediate goals.
The ACC announced suppliers will be directly paid for agricultural inputs, which would enhance their cash flows and avoid risks of accumulated debts owed to farmers.
The ACC said this step “genuinely” reflects the “true” partnership between the public and private sectors and constitutes a “feasible model” for achieving sustainable development and enhancing financial and production stability in the Jordanian agricultural sector.
